Output ed07e4ff17536d0e7c94d697d0aad53b564161d8a416b4e07a641615aa0da702:0

value
126277994
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f8334eb80a3be3e7a611069d466cfe1844f15544 OP_EQUAL
address
3QKNy2QM5AJEbuj7SUyUwLZpsEEvMsRLKp
transaction
ed07e4ff17536d0e7c94d697d0aad53b564161d8a416b4e07a641615aa0da702
confirmations
380335
spent
true